Customization of codecs and sound quality

One of the main reasons for the instability is mismatch codecs. Smartphone and headphones can try to use different compression algorithms, which leads to buffering and jerks. In modern versions of Android, a selection of codecs is available in the menu for developers.

To activate this menu, go to Settings โ†’ On the phone and press quickly 7-10 once on the line โ€œVersionโ€ MIUIยป. After you have become a developer, go back to the main settings menu and select โ€œMoreยป โ†’ ยซFor developers. Find the Bluetooth Audio Codec section.

โš ๏ธ Note: Change the codec to a better quality (for example, LDAC) It can reduce connection stability if the headphones are far from the phone or in the jamming zone.

Try switching to SBC or AAC if you have persistent breaks, they're less bandwidth-intensive, and if you want the best quality and the devices support aptX HD or LDAC, make sure the distance between them is minimal.

  • ๐ŸŽต SBC: Basic codec, maximum compatibility and stability.
  • ๐ŸŽง AAC: Optimal for Apple devices and many Android headphones.
  • ๐Ÿ”Š AptX: A Good Balance of Quality and Latency for Android.
  • ๐Ÿš€ LDAC: High resolution, but requires ideal reception conditions.
How does audio compression work?
Codecs compress the audio stream to transmit over a narrow Bluetooth channel. The higher the compression ratio and the more complex the algorithm, the more data you need to transmit per unit of time, which increases the requirements for signal quality. When received poorly, complex codecs (LDACs) automatically lower the bitrate or break the connection, while the SBC continues to work steadily, albeit with lower sound quality.

Effects of physical factors and accessories

Remember that a smartphone is a physical device that is influenced by external factors: Metal cases, magnetic mounts and even tight palm contact with the bottom of the phone can shield the signal. Bluetooth antennas in Xiaomi are often located at the bottom or top of the case.

Check if the antenna area is covered with a thick, metal-coated cover. If you use a wide-framed protective glass, it can also distort the directional pattern. Try removing the cover and checking the communication quality.

Itโ€™s also important to consider the location of Wi-Fi routers. Since both Wi-Fi (2.4GHz) and Bluetooth operate in the same frequency range, they can jam each other. If the router is next to the phone, try switching Wi-Fi to 5GHz in the router settings.

  • ๐Ÿ›ก๏ธ Remove a metal or too thick case for inspection.
  • ๐Ÿ“ถ Move your phone away from microwave ovens and powerful routers.
  • ๐Ÿคฒ Do not close the bottom of your smartphone while talking or listening.
  • ๐Ÿ”Œ Avoid using cheap ones. USB-charging near the phone when Bluetooth is working, they create strong interference.

Specifics of work in MIUI and HyperOS

Xiaomiโ€™s shells have their own power-saving management features that often conflict with Bluetoothโ€™s constant operation. The system can kill the playback process or the back-channel clock to save charge. Itโ€™s not a bug, itโ€™s aggressive optimization.

To prevent this, you need to set exceptions for important apps. Go to Settings โ†’ Apps โ†’ All apps, find your app for music or wearables (like Zepp Life or Galaxy Wearable). From the Charge Savings menu, select No Limits option.

โš ๏ธ Warning: Enabling the โ€œNo Limitsโ€ option will cause the app to be constantly active in the background, which can increase battery consumption on the back of the app. 5-10% day-to-day.

Also check autorun settings. Make sure the services you want are autorun. Some versions of HyperOS have Advanced Bluetooth, which automatically switches codecs and power depending on the use case โ€” make sure it's activated.
